Hart-tish Campground

Located in southwest Oregon in the Rogue River-Siskiyou National Forest, Hart-Tish Park is surrounded by a variety of landscapes, boasting nearby volcanic peaks, rivers and old-growth forests. Hart-Tish Park offers several acres of beautifully groomed lawn sloping down to the shores of Applegate Lake. Visitors can spot the peaks of the majestic Red Buttes Wilderness while looking south over the lake. Hart-tish offers day use areas for swimmers, and the convenience of a cement boat ramp for those looking to launch their boats! The Applegate Lake borders the campground making the view worth the drive. Hart-tish has eight tent sites set in shaded trees, all with their own campfire and BBQ pits. RV sites are located in front of the general store, and offer visitors a spectacular view of the lake. All of the campsites are dry camping (no water); however, there is a clean and modern restroom for your convenience. For a small day use fee, you can launch your boat at the cement dock and enjoy the beautiful Applegate Lake. Trails around the lake provide hikers and mountain bikers room to roam. Kayak and stand up paddleboard (SUP) rentals are also available. Hart-Tish park is one of the few Forest Service campgrounds with several acres of beautifully groomed lawn sloping down to the water’s edge. From Hart-Tish one can look south across the lake to the peaks of the majestic Red Buttes Wilderness . The boat ramp is usable until the lake drops below 1,928 feet (above sea level) or when the facility is closed for winter. Nearby Hiking Opportunities: Applegate Lake trail system, including Da-ku-be-te-de Trail , Grouse Loop Trail , and the Collings Mountain Trail . The site is operated by a concessionaire . Before you go

Season

early May – mid-September

Reservations

Reservations accepted

Fees

Standard Campsites (non-electric tent sites): $30/night • Dry RV Sites (8 available): $30/night • Group Site: $75/night • Day use : $7 • Boat Launch: $10

Restrictions

Quiet hours between 10 p.m. and 6 a.m. • Campfires in developed fire pits only • Fireworks are prohibited • Dogs are allowed • OHV/ATV use prohibited • 10 m.p.h. speed limit on Applegate Lake

Accessibility

Accessible fishing access.
